Difference between a sixpence and a Dutch 25ct are very small.
Size 6D19.4 mm. Size 25ct 19mm.
Thickness 6D 1.50mm. Thickness 25ct 1.55 mm.
Weight 6D 2.83 Gr. Weight 25ct 3 Gr.

If you want to test all the payouts, it's usually best done with the mech out of the case, but by chance your particular type of machine allows you to do it with the mech in the case as well.
So with the door open, put in a coin and pull the handle, as soon as the reels start to spin quickly push a cloth into the mech low on the left side(you will see a fan spinning there, your intention is to block the fan from spinning, no damage will be done). Once the fan stops the reels will freewheel, stop them by hand and position them for the desired win and hold them in place while you pull out the cloth, the fan starts up again and the cycle continues. once it ends the machine will deal with the payout you set up by hand.
Also, remember that these card style reel strips are not unusual, most aristos in Australia had them and they were used in Europe to a much lesser degree as well, your machine has been altered considerably from lighting to glass changes so payouts might also be unusual, list them all and check they pay the same every time (if the machine is set to take 6d then using ANY other coin will most likely affect the payout numbers) and let us know. :cool:

Cleaning and lightly polishing the slides should help. Don't oil them though - that will cause them to stick and accumulate dirt.
